Repairing a Sagging Door
A sagging door can be a problem, often triggered by loose hinges or a deformed frame.

Materials Needed:
ScrewdriverWood shimLevel
Actions:
Check Hinge Screws: Inspect the hinge screws for tightness. If they are loose, tighten them using a screwdriver.Use a Level: Place a level versus the door to see how far it is drooping.Place Shims: If the door is sagging considerably, place a wood shim behind the top hinge. This can assist raise the door back into location.Re-tighten Screws: After adjusting the shim, re-tighten the hinge screws. Test the door and make more adjustments if necessary.Repairing a Sticky Door
A sticky door can be triggered by humidity, temperature level modifications, or misalignment.

Materials Needed:
Sandpaper or a hand aircraftScrewdriver
Actions:
Inspect for Rubbing: Close the door and check which areas are rubbing against the frame.Remove Door if Necessary: If significant adjustment is required, eliminate the door using a screwdriver.Sand the Rubbing Areas: Use sandpaper or a hand aircraft to shave down the areas that are sticking. Be patient and test frequently.Rehang and Adjust: Rehang the door and make any final modifications.Changing a Door Lock

The expense of door repairs can vary considerably based upon the kind of repair needed and your geographic location. Below is a basic summary of expected costs:
Repair TypeApproximated Cost RangeHinge repairs₤ 10 - ₤ 50Frame repair₤ 50 - ₤ 200Lock replacement₤ 30 - ₤ 150Surface refinishing₤ 50 - ₤ 300Weather removing₤ 10 - ₤ 50
Keep in mind: The costs might leave out any potential labor charges if employing an expert.
Regularly Asked Questions About Door Repairs1. How do I know if my door needs repair?
Indications of damage, trouble in opening or closing, and noticeable wear and tear are signs that your door may require repair.
2. Can I repair my door myself, or should I hire a professional?
Many little repairs can be done by property owners with basic tools. However, for intricate problems, or if you do not have the needed skills, it may be smart to employ a professional.
3. How typically should I examine my doors?
Periodic inspections (at least once a year) are suggested to ensure that doors remain in great condition. Search for indications of damage and resolve any issues promptly.
4. What materials are best for door repairs?
For wooden doors, wood glue and wood filler are perfect, while metal doors might need a metal patching compound. Constantly use weather-resistant materials for outdoor doors.
5. Can a distorted door be fixed?
In most cases, a distorted door can be repaired by realigning or changing the hinges or by using wetness and heat to restore the initial shape. However, severe warping might require door replacement.
